Great song relating back to the days when colored film became available. Colorful images and shots of old Kodak cameras underscore the influence Kodak had on all of us amateur photographers. Written and recorded by Paul Simon. Appeared in his 1973 album, "There Goes Rhymin' Simon"

Kodachrome was the result of nearly a century of experimentation by various chemists, Daguerreotypists, and photographers. One of the first processes to be commercially available was "Kromscop," in the 1890s. Kodachrome put color photography into a regular, non-specialized camera that could also be used for traditional BW photography.
